Since joining the Lakers, Austin Reaves has been getting hit in the face by his opponents’ elbows quite often. A recent example of that was during the game against the Warriors when Jonathan Kuminga knocked the shooting guard when trying to post him up.

Reaves needed ice to believe a swell under his left eye, but was able to continue the game. Afterwards he was asked about the recurring elbow hits that he is getting.

“I don’t know, it probably says I’m not very smart for taking hits all the time,” the 24-year-old shooting guard smiled. “I don’t know, I just try to be in the right position at the right time and sometimes that’s the wrong position at the right time. I got two free-throws, I bricked one, I’mma blame it on being hit. It’s part of the game.”

Reaves finished the game with 8 points. He was given a major assignment in defense in the fourth quarter as he was guarding Klay Thompson.
